| Message ID | 20250713073746.43627-1-dario.binacchi@amarulasolutions.com | 
|---|---|
| State | New | 
| Headers | show
   Return-Path: 
 <linux-amarula+bncBCQ4XFG47UFRBYWEZXBQMGQERDO5XJY@amarulasolutions.com>
X-Original-To: linux-amarula@patchwork.amarulasolutions.com
Delivered-To: linux-amarula@patchwork.amarulasolutions.com
Received: from mail-ed1-f71.google.com (mail-ed1-f71.google.com
 [209.85.208.71])
	by ganimede.amarulasolutions.com (Postfix) with ESMTPS id 2E0373F13C
	for <linux-amarula@patchwork.amarulasolutions.com>;
 Sun, 13 Jul 2025 09:38:12 +0200 (CEST)
Received: by mail-ed1-f71.google.com with SMTP id
 4fb4d7f45d1cf-60c776678edsf4093097a12.1
        for <linux-amarula@patchwork.amarulasolutions.com>;
 Sun, 13 Jul 2025 00:38:12 -0700 (PDT)
ARC-Seal: i=2; a=rsa-sha256; t=1752392291; cv=pass;
        d=google.com; s=arc-20240605;
        b=Cv878oDwX/44oPGS2MFupg2balVzJbGxlfqv7PLK++Rlcvujtv4ls3r0iJy1BVh6nu
         uPIeTqZBrru1ymNrMpHgiexT0UoOuBQD9QGav2RasmTPlpVfL6ac5LyGVzDzeS602WV+
         mEsykoLgsSy5LpuUOp/WBNLe0YYZm3hhaNNZmZMCtrKNZs35xPSl/q4AbUo2BFNSg3EV
         90qLI4YU+UG+lDlAjZLQr5HZIM/El7QTGAq9h1I8G3HykVVeReMr3fMUSk/n1J/UQ07v
         jJut2sHrgp+7+nseGam1SDKTYQ+0DoPwT05dLrFj3mQ5G6kWu7jRU6o7EbxYHBypDWNI
         S6MA==
ARC-Message-Signature: i=2; a=rsa-sha256; c=relaxed/relaxed; d=google.com;
 s=arc-20240605;
        h=list-unsubscribe:list-archive:list-help:list-post:list-id
         :mailing-list:precedence:content-transfer-encoding:mime-version
         :message-id:date:subject:cc:to:from:dkim-signature;
        bh=EGmxvuLD+1ZtZXoomjjgPnraThxJ8Ax77oYbOAMbepM=;
        fh=Q5OicZfkkhJeLgsXDQbQpLpiknjofzVykGq9UsKElKA=;
        b=lRU5cCpBwPd4Ndsrx1tXGUQYoLFQrbG+fpYWNsSwLhQLUv1nARySqHJoZf06Y8QkuC
         8sBHLbTIWkRGce2NulJ3RjfdjnlpjH5GbvoZwSK2CDW0eNsZEd5STzn8rlEijsJdYUnW
         Nudcv60azoOZVwLtnTwszDQLoJHGSf23fOUh/6+g3RyfxKqefb0VRZ96jLx3loyskA7p
         ygGwtWrti6U7xhfAjPKatsZmZ9pVpVBBox3QTRqWHWckS5PxgbpYSvp/sHwPwUKQ2wjU
         49naUy93YTNgkwAszSAr8TCX7QUjkO+FO3gL4nOaPrXq/BBnwy+1T0snuaCV7068UfIk
         gxMA==;
        darn=patchwork.amarulasolutions.com
ARC-Authentication-Results: i=2; mx.google.com;
       dkim=pass header.i=@amarulasolutions.com header.s=google
 header.b=ESoQXVOh;
       spf=pass (google.com: domain of dario.binacchi@amarulasolutions.com
 designates 209.85.220.41 as permitted sender)
 smtp.mailfrom=dario.binacchi@amarulasolutions.com;
       d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=amarulasolutions.com;
       dara=pass header.i=@amarulasolutions.com
D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ed;
        d=amarulasolutions.com; s=google; t=1752392291; x=1752997091;
 darn=patchwork.amarulasolutions.com;
        h=list-unsubscribe:list-archive:list-help:list-post:list-id
         :mailing-list:precedence:x-original-authentication-results
         :x-original-sender:content-transfer-encoding:mime-version:message-id
         :date:subject:cc:to:from:from:to:cc:subject:date:message-id:reply-to;
        bh=EGmxvuLD+1ZtZXoomjjgPnraThxJ8Ax77oYbOAMbepM=;
        b=SKsrtBl01A5gxQ91McQO7nB/16ILG8+HoR2DpjA3U1yil/eJxqjsEaHVQlJ+BVAFIw
         XKPHNsFj7nvD3ORtawafzw0fYo1sEDFIaarB1TwISnyAj5zwXvvbIgL0WfcfYDixTrQb
         g35iifK6/JvRrvxUWmUS5fwn7ru/+H8H7CXBc=
X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ed;
        d=1e100.net; s=20230601; t=1752392291; x=1752997091;
        h=list-unsubscribe:list-archive:list-help:list-post
         :x-spam-checked-in-group:list-id:mailing-list:precedence
         :x-original-authentication-results:x-original-sender
         :content-transfer-encoding:mime-version:message-id:date:subject:cc
         :to:from:x-beenthere:x-gm-message-state:from:to:cc:subject:date
         :message-id:reply-to;
        bh=EGmxvuLD+1ZtZXoomjjgPnraThxJ8Ax77oYbOAMbepM=;
        b=e9XNwIR4ODoiGTpIIJGDq0DLuFlcLtZ3+Fplt/T5s69FFxSA8AB/FNYBNeSKOzIZ3w
         F2LPI7Ck4mcwMSFNNsDhFvCXOsZb5Rt2I5KSrkIqEviTYK4Ea19ehGAzzdWb61CcIFP7
         rumIslu/SJQD7zULnJO5Mgp6rB/pr6RSs2ahvl4K4wUq0X1JNOk3xrZGoaHaY4wb5+y2
         wMEH5dKwiBEi3M2A3yrLK4RVAQQmCJHz2PXpKJHvb6UIeM9h/8wL9Bewo4t86VEWENiL
         VI06KxbCDyBDcpFyIDxLtZn2m6K8CGPs/1PUNV0lKRhtT2GnxK7bThKmnp/rAfFEggZs
         akCg==
X-Forwarded-Encrypted: i=2;
 AJvYcCVbpL+r5D5i0MNdfxy4+3gXxR5V5dkkUt1KwXp4vuxdVvq0lTOycQQ1QfRM4x5f0sQWuQ+YFZujJihb5UND@patchwork.amarulasolutions.com
X-Gm-Message-State: AOJu0YzRIcJdRxNp5ZuNlQL3/pY52IkBYc1RFuTzDYF567LWaMFf7oRz
	KvLCpJe1P4UCxAtifRpa4wzpAMzF6kg4fsKwBOGXgndWF8mxylBuHr3mMLFKlsZgi/ar9g==
X-Google-Smtp-Source: 
 AGHT+IGp1pcsBT10YmjXYYDyRRuX0TJi+nqyPiA2d6ypr4iLTfvzGNa6+ejvuwLCsD12kE2tkx5efw==
X-Received: by 2002:a05:6402:5388:b0:60f:c32a:834 with SMTP id
 4fb4d7f45d1cf-611c1cd5992mr10429067a12.5.1752392291482;
        Sun, 13 Jul 2025 00:38:11 -0700 (PDT)
X-BeenThere: linux-amarula@amarulasolutions.com;
 h=AZMbMZf5uvd33VnAGhm+B7LOXOHnYzucHIC8U6p58zr3sDta2g==
Received: by 2002:a05:6402:2345:b0:609:aa85:8d81 with SMTP id
 4fb4d7f45d1cf-611c0d5798cls2079346a12.2.-pod-prod-00-eu; Sun, 13 Jul 2025
 00:38:09 -0700 (PDT)
X-Received: by 2002:a05:6402:1941:b0:60c:5e47:3af5 with SMTP id
 4fb4d7f45d1cf-611c1cb7445mr12150472a12.4.1752392288940;
        Sun, 13 Jul 2025 00:38:08 -0700 (PDT)
ARC-Seal: i=1; a=rsa-sha256; t=1752392288; cv=none;
        d=google.com; s=arc-20240605;
        b=UxCH80o6jJCMmgNQ0HOK7nO6bVEZ9AWSckhhwXO10g9uYhFSsoLAboWV69Q6J7JeRe
         5A0GnnE75w91GEHyTiJzsrUjYVQzdsQq2vORQTNO7Laj9bE7YV3PABkBCOIGnC5935SS
         KyNGP6panyLkdXPor0ZP9jH+rNti40HQTYgQo7oW40hRXYMhl8jGEZjypdpib8rN3otk
         RB+kLGdYAxHrJLqwf0qpKfCZHCr0uZEuMiTHff0kmueeBKRf9VuawvrD1LLT2E8ly/MZ
         WGEEtKMwfpDse20o0NEtlzK3jHcTte/lv+VAiEb99e29BQK8XWDx6ZQCCW81PQEWMD04
         wE/Q==
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com;
 s=arc-20240605;
        h=content-transfer-encoding:mime-version:message-id:date:subject:cc
         :to:from:dkim-signature;
        bh=G767Oigo0FerenWxFtwU0p5/pvV+AKaYJMBLK+y/3UI=;
        fh=xL93vR91oL6vJeRDFO9nwGkWxT6CThWZG5T985ut5Tw=;
        b=jCEMkugE5yXxLVp/SP45RlwM0FdIOnK9/56oPOqy6aU/w3Rsw3GVHD6eKPyrnbd/Fi
         StUvd9KnMF0TP6UVBRRvIqLcaGozOccoEBbTRlVUTv8WCuVMafkuS0kwjGSAC2N7Zhdo
         C/5MxjnI0vpqNnng91MrQHlFaknkLfBcZTB2skZchl44QFGN2qnXXgGv5n8p77859KUo
         YNa+FdrnXPxTxwXD9xnVE3RBHvcnFHYDWNcuBNxn1zMPZRMs8dhfWnONnRFM38wfdSAV
         VFNs3/+DF7YNWwjUxe765fvYJiMswhDLtSvsMY8uHCOs2WAMo/+3cb1/ChNiBU1swbJ9
         +7Zg==;
        dara=google.com
ARC-Authentication-Results: i=1; mx.google.com;
       dkim=pass header.i=@amarulasolutions.com header.s=google
 header.b=ESoQXVOh;
       spf=pass (google.com: domain of dario.binacchi@amarulasolutions.com
 designates 209.85.220.41 as permitted sender)
 smtp.mailfrom=dario.binacchi@amarulasolutions.com;
       d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=amarulasolutions.com;
       dara=pass header.i=@amarulasolutions.com
Received: from mail-sor-f41.google.com (mail-sor-f41.google.com.
 [209.85.220.41])
        by mx.google.com with SMTPS id
 4fb4d7f45d1cf-6119c6c7e50sor3475467a12.6.2025.07.13.00.38.08
        for <linux-amarula@amarulasolutions.com>
        (Google Transport Security);
        Sun, 13 Jul 2025 00:38:08 -0700 (PDT)
Received-SPF: pass (google.com: domain of dario.binacchi@amarulasolutions.com
 designates 209.85.220.41 as permitted sender) client-ip=209.85.220.41;
X-Gm-Gg: ASbGncsIhVaBvLD4FhOy5eeaUYyGxTt8YrGcRxkEf4LAw/eburO/wbWjKHYXMXsjFSy
	j50nj0P6IS7ouw9XZVshgXvobNivIDzjrpYtpII8BoZvTtSbOfRVKDKtoiOqZRBuzccD5ftAICP
	aYSHbdo6kNOL23fOmpbqU++1HnrM7D10DPmDcsjXTfRmppU2G5H0MoQZhn3Wgwr5TyrcqLJUnWx
	3qaheUvC/l7oIUjF8R5artTd+copVsJMHvINdOO2IihtR612bnAPaIAMonw05fd4d/CtpZX4wHy
	IWXy+T+BGjuUWsrqiyG23rOx6CI/MrnrZX/z9AuB50Somkf7UC6J7/Gf+6HacaDDtGZAUeslQVt
	6+AFSLgcU9j5EtVzjmcdTbZJtHtpVTGF8zMVjq73I9zMPM5GRfBsLv1Qr7drdLYNsQkLGQXgA0z
	HJ+ndmZtU8xJGUSgoO5ukUuZWJvn+p2aIYfZ+C1csOKQ+8+F1wphH4At0D8A==
X-Received: by 2002:a05:6402:35d3:b0:60c:679e:b957 with SMTP id
 4fb4d7f45d1cf-611c1cb733fmr12954114a12.1.1752392288174;
        Sun, 13 Jul 2025 00:38:08 -0700 (PDT)
Received: from dario-ThinkPad-P14s-Gen-5.homenet.telecomitalia.it
 (host-87-5-95-99.retail.telecomitalia.it. [87.5.95.99])
        by smtp.gmail.com with ESMTPSA id
 4fb4d7f45d1cf-611c973439bsm4568952a12.47.2025.07.13.00.38.05
        (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256);
        Sun, 13 Jul 2025 00:38:07 -0700 (PDT)
From: Dario Binacchi <dario.binacchi@amarulasolutions.com>
To: openembedded-devel@lists.openembedded.org
Cc: linux-amarula@amarulasolutions.com,
	Dario Binacchi <dario.binacchi@amarulasolutions.com>
Subject: [meta-filesystems][PATCH] ufs-utils: upgrade 6.14.11 -> 7.14.11
Date: Sun, 13 Jul 2025 09:37:46 +0200
Message-ID: <20250713073746.43627-1-dario.binacchi@amarulasolutions.com>
X-Mailer: git-send-email 2.43.0
MIME-Version: 1.0
Content-Type: text/plain; charset="UTF-8"
Content-Transfer-Encoding: quoted-printable
X-Original-Sender: dario.binacchi@amarulasolutions.com
X-Original-Authentication-Results: mx.google.com;       dkim=pass
 header.i=@amarulasolutions.com header.s=google header.b=ESoQXVOh;
       spf=pass (google.com: domain of dario.binacchi@amarulasolutions.com
 designates 209.85.220.41 as permitted sender)
 smtp.mailfrom=dario.binacchi@amarulasolutions.com;
       d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=amarulasolutions.com;
       dara=pass header.i=@amarulasolutions.com
Precedence: list
Mailing-list: list linux-amarula@amarulasolutions.com;
 contact linux-amarula+owners@amarulasolutions.com
List-ID: <linux-amarula.amarulasolutions.com>
X-Spam-Checked-In-Group: linux-amarula@amarulasolutions.com
X-Google-Group-Id: 476853432473
List-Post: 
 <https://groups.google.com/a/amarulasolutions.com/group/linux-amarula/post>,
 <mailto:linux-amarula@amarulasolutions.com>
List-Help: 
 <https://support.google.com/a/amarulasolutions.com/bin/topic.py?topic=25838>,
 <mailto:linux-amarula+help@amarulasolutions.com>
List-Archive: 
 <https://groups.google.com/a/amarulasolutions.com/group/linux-amarula/>
List-Unsubscribe: 
 <mailto:googlegroups-manage+476853432473+unsubscribe@googlegroups.com>,
 <https://groups.google.com/a/amarulasolutions.com/group/linux-amarula/subscribe>
    | 
 
| Series | 
   
  | 
 
| Related | 
   show
   
  | 
 
diff --git a/meta-filesystems/recipes-utils/ufs-utils/ufs-utils_6.14.11.bb b/meta-filesystems/recipes-utils/ufs-utils/ufs-utils_7.14.11.bb similarity index 80% rename from meta-filesystems/recipes-utils/ufs-utils/ufs-utils_6.14.11.bb rename to meta-filesystems/recipes-utils/ufs-utils/ufs-utils_7.14.11.bb index a22e54e24c44..50b6b5a16cfd 100644 --- a/meta-filesystems/recipes-utils/ufs-utils/ufs-utils_6.14.11.bb +++ b/meta-filesystems/recipes-utils/ufs-utils/ufs-utils_7.14.11.bb @@ -4,7 +4,7 @@ LIC_FILES_CHKSUM = "file://COPYING;md5=59530bdf33659b29e73d4adb9f9f6552" BRANCH ?= "dev" -SRCREV = "5539a8ad8e1a9b7ea8b62213ed72eb939c5381b7" +SRCREV = "92c8e4d732c34f8d0754d0e076879ca7008bace4" SRC_URI = "git://github.com/westerndigitalcorporation/ufs-utils.git;protocol=https;branch=${BRANCH} \ " @@ -14,7 +14,8 @@ UPSTREAM_CHECK_COMMITS = "1" EXTRA_OEMAKE = "CROSS_COMPILE=${TARGET_PREFIX} CC="${CC}" CFLAGS="${CFLAGS}"" -CFLAGS:append:mipsarchn64 = " -D__SANE_USERSPACE_TYPES__ -D_GNU_SOURCE" +CFLAGS:append = " -D_GNU_SOURCE" +CFLAGS:append:mipsarchn64 = " -D__SANE_USERSPACE_TYPES__" do_configure() { sed -i -e "s|-static$||g" ${S}/Makefile
Extending _GNU_SOURCE to the CFGLAS of all platforms, not just mipsarchn64, was necessary to fix the following error raised during the compilation of the new version: ufs_emon.c: In function ‘do_emon’: ufs_emon.c:455:51: error: ‘O_DIRECT’ undeclared (first use in this function); did you mean ‘O_DIRECTORY’? 455 | fill_data_fd = open("fill_file", O_RDWR | O_DIRECT | O_CREAT, | ^~~~~~~~ | O_DIRECTORY ufs_emon.c:455:51: note: each undeclared identifier is reported only once for each function it appears in This _GNU_SOURCE define was added upstream in commit [1] in the Makefile default CFLAGS, but since Yocto redefines those it needs to be added back. Release notes: https://github.com/SanDisk-Open-Source/ufs-utils/releases/tag/v7.14.11 [1] https://github.com/SanDisk-Open-Source/ufs-utils/commit/183e0deb28f13cfb3caf161fc6d0f3cd1edb05c2 Signed-off-by: Dario Binacchi <dario.binacchi@amarulasolutions.com> --- .../ufs-utils/{ufs-utils_6.14.11.bb => ufs-utils_7.14.11.bb} |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) rename meta-filesystems/recipes-utils/ufs-utils/{ufs-utils_6.14.11.bb => ufs-utils_7.14.11.bb} (80%)